Chapman, Leona Martha, one of eleven children born to Charles and Mary (Darwish) Taylor, was born on April 26, 1919 in Bloomington, Ill. She died Nov. 14, 2008 at the age of 89 years. Leona was playful at heart with a contagious laugh and sense of humor. She enjoyed life with her family and friends and valued the memories and moments with all. Leona was preceded in death by her husband, Jackson; daughter, Debra; four brothers and four sisters. She will be remembered and loved forever by her daughter and son-in-law, Christine and Tom Russell of York, Pa.; grandchildren, Matthew and Sara Russell of Hillsboro, Ore., Phillip Russell of McLean, Va.; sisters, Pauline Skaff and Elaine Otwell both of Wichita.
